King Battles Hard but Falls 2-0 at Lees-McRae

King University visited Tate Field on Tuesday, October 21, 2025, for a Conference Carolinas matchup against Lees-McRae College, falling 2-0 to the Bobcats.

Match Overview
  • Location: Tate Field, Lees-McRae College
  • Final Score: Lees-McRae 2, King 0
  • Kickoff: 4:30 PM
  • Records: King (4-5-3, CC 3-5-2), Lees-McRae (3-3-7, CC 3-3-5)
Game Recap
King came under early pressure, conceding both goals in the first half. Lees-McRae's Jonas Bartelt led the way, scoring with assists from Adam Condron and Owen Smith. Despite the early deficit, King's defense responded with a resilient effort. Goalkeeper Gavin Roux made six saves, anchoring the back line and keeping the Bobcats scoreless after halftime. Midfielders Campbell Moore and Anderson Moore recorded the team's only shots as the Tornado struggled to break through a disciplined Lees-McRae defense. King managed two corner kicks in a match where offensive chances were limited.

Looking Ahead
King University will aim to rebound on Saturday, October 25, when they travel to face Emmanuel. Kickoff is set for 7:00 p.m.
